    Healthcare Challenges in Torres Strait Islands

    Delivering healthcare across the Torres Strait presents unique challenges that few providers are equipped to address. The islands span a vast area, accessible only by sea or air, with weather and tides influencing travel schedules. Limited local infrastructure means specialist services must often travel to communities rather than expecting residents to travel to the mainland.

    Cultural considerations are equally important. Torres Strait Islander communities have distinct traditions, family structures, and approaches to health and healing. Effective healthcare delivery requires working alongside traditional practices and respecting community protocols around decision-making and family involvement in care.
